## Runbook: API v3 Pagination Rollout

Plugin authors: v3 of the Larkspan REST API switches from offset to cursor pagination. Offset params return 410 after the cutover. Update clients to follow the `next_cursor` field. Signed plugin builds remain mandatory post-rollout. Sign your release bundle with the key below:

rollout seal: bky6_osViJn

Onboarding note for the Ledgerpane admin table: bulk edits are applied through the batcher service, not directly against the database. Select rows, choose an action, and the batcher stages changes in a pending set you can review before commit. Edits over 500 rows require a second approver — this is enforced server-side, so don't try to chunk around it. To run the batcher locally you need the staging write credential, which goes in your .env as the next line.

secret setting of bahip-kagag: RELAY_SECRET3=c83

UserSplit Cutover Drift: the extracted account service and the legacy Marigold monolith user module are reporting divergent record counts during dual-write. This fires when drift exceeds 0.5% over 15 minutes. New team members should not replay writes manually. Reconciliation steps and the rollback procedure are documented on the internal page.

wiki page, tajog-fafog: https://gitlab.paliqsys.corp/dash/display/job/853dd6fcbf54